608608.5 MEASUREMENT and PAYMENT

WY · 2021 Standard SpecificationsBook pages 00View official source ↗

608.5.1 General 1 The engineer will measure:

1.Concrete, Sidewalk (Conc), Bike Path (Conc), Median Paving (Conc), and Ditch

Paving (Conc) by the square foot [square meter] or square yard [square meter] of paved surface. Measurement will be parallel to the paved surface.

2.Curb ramps as Sidewalk (Conc), including curb returns and interior curbs.
3.Driveways and approaches as Sidewalk (Conc), if the same thickness as the

adjacent sidewalk. 2 The department will pay as follows:

608.5.2 Referenced Sections for Direct Payment 1 When specified, the engineer will measure and pay for:

1.Bed Course Material in accordance with Section 301, Aggregate Materials.

Measurement specified by the cubic yard [cubic meter] will be based on neat lines.

2.The area of curb ramps located on the street side of the back-of-curb line as Curb

and Gutter in accordance with Section 609, Curb and Gutter.

3.Driveways and approaches, including the sidewalk within the boundary of the

driveway, as Double Gutter in accordance with Section 609, Curb and Gutter, when a thicker section than the adjacent sidewalk is specified.

4.Unclassified Excavation in accordance with Section 203, Excavation and

Embankment.

Curb and Gutter

609.1DESCRIPTION

1 This section describes the requirements for constructing curb and gutter.

609.2MATERIALS

1 Provide materials in accordance with the following:

609.3EQUIPMENT

1 Ensure that equipment meets the following:

Equipment

Subsection

Batch Plant Mixers Placing Equipment

513.3.1 513.3.2 513.3.3

Use a slip-form machine capable of placing, spreading, consolidating, screeding, and finishing concrete in one complete pass, providing a dense and homogeneous section with minimal hand finishing. Ensure that the forming tube portion of the extrusion machine can be readily adjusted vertically during forward motion to produce a variable curb height matching the predetermined curb grade.
